Ticket #882 — Turnstile vault won't open, again

Hey plugin folks — the Clickgate counter vault for Ravenshall Stadium locked itself after the weekend firmware push, so your plugins can't pull gate tallies right now. We've confirmed it's the known auto-seal bug, not your code. While we patch it, you can unseal your own sandbox copy manually. Use the recovery passphrase below.

unlock words, hahip-yagef: zorok-novmir-zorix-silax

UserSplit Cutover Drift: the extracted account service and the legacy Marigold monolith user module are reporting divergent record counts during dual-write. This fires when drift exceeds 0.5% over 15 minutes. New team members should not replay writes manually. Reconciliation steps and the rollback procedure are documented on the internal page.

wiki page, tajog-fafog: https://gitlab.paliqsys.corp/dash/display/job/853dd6fcbf54

**Management Minutes — Orvane Software**

For the incoming director. Reseller programme reviewed. Eleven partners active; three underperforming against quota. Margins tightened to 18% on the Lattice suite. Dalia Rourke proposed tiered incentives; approved in principle. Kestrel Channel pilot in Norbay extended one quarter. Partner portal rebuild deferred. Next review in six weeks. The confidential note below sets out the plan going forward.

confidential, kagup-bafog: Fraaxax Group is in early talks to buy Soroxox Group for about $343.8 million. The Olidor launch date is June 14, and nothing goes to the press before then. Legal wants the Aldmirek Logistics term sheet signed before July 23.

Subject: Resizer CLI cut-over complete

Welcome aboard. The batch image resizer (shrinkit) moved off the old Varnholt runner last night. All jobs now go through the new queue. Old scripts are deprecated; use the v3 CLI only. Docs are on the wiki. The tool reads its runtime settings from the block below.

config for kafof-bawef:
holath:
  log_level: debug
  metrics_host: metrics.holath.qorvelsys.internal
  pin: 2191
  pool_size: 32